Released on November 12, 2002, by VP and Atlantic Records, Dutty Rock was Sean Paul’s sophomore album. It became a commercial juggernaut, fundamentally altering the global music landscape by introducing dancehall to mainstream audiences worldwide. The album eventually sold over six million copies globally, earned a Grammy Award for Best Reggae Album in 2004, and was certified Triple Platinum by the RIAA.
